History and Growth:
On-line poker surfaced when you look at the belated 1990s as a consequence of breakthroughs in technology in addition to net. The first on-line poker area, earth Poker, was released in 1998, attracting a tiny but passionate neighborhood. However, it was in the early 2000s that on-line poker experienced exponential development, mainly because of the intro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.

Benefits of Online Poker:
Internet poker provides a few benefits over standard brick-and-mortar gambling enterprises. Firstly, it gives a larger variety of game choices, including different poker variations and stakes, catering on preferences and budgets of most kinds of players. Also, online poker areas are available 24/7, getting rid of the constraints of physical casino operating hours. Additionally, on the web systems often offer attractive incentives, respect programs, and capability to play several tables simultaneously, improving the general gaming experience.
